The previously announced PSYREN anime revealed a new key visual, along with an October 2026 release date and updated character information. Studio SATELIGHT is in charge of the animation, with Katsumi Ono as the director. It was also confirmed that it will be a complete adaptation, covering the entirety of the story.

The main voice cast includes Rikuya Yasuda as protagonist Ageha Yoshina and Mayuko Kazama as Sakurako Amamiya. They are supported by Shunsuke Takeuchi as Hiryu Asaga, Soma Saito as Oboro Mochizuki, and Yukihiro Nozuyama as Kabuto Kirisaki. The staff of the series includes:
- Original Work by Toshiaki Iwashiro (Published by Shueisha)
- Directed by Katsumi Ono
- Series Composition by Shin Yoshida
- Character Design by Akira Okuma
- Music by Takashi Ohmama, Tatsuhiko Saiki, Shu Kanematsu
- Animation Production by SATELIGHT
The series is described as follows:
One day, high schooler Ageha Yoshina picks up a mysterious “red phone card” left behind in a public telephone booth. A few days later, his childhood friend and classmate, Sakurako Amamiya—who possessed the same card—suddenly vanishes without a trace. In search of her, Ageha finds himself drawn into the rumors surrounding a nationwide string of mysterious disappearances, said to be the work of a secret organization known only as “Psyren.” When he accesses the group, a deadly game begins—one that will change his fate forever.
